Bold Shapes vs. Spray Texture

Graffiti art splits into two vectorization approaches: bold letterform outlines and shapes convert cleanly in color mode with a moderate palette, while authentic spray-paint texture and drip effects need higher color counts or a photo preset to capture the gradient spray edges realistically.

  • Bold outline shapes: color mode, 6-16 colors
  • Spray texture and drips: photo preset with posterization
  • Separate flat color layers from texture for editing flexibility

Merch, Decals, and Mural Reproduction

Vectorized graffiti pieces cut as large vinyl wall decals reproducing a mural at any wall size, print on apparel and skateboard decks at full color fidelity, and scale down for logo-style branding that channels street-art energy without losing the piece's bold character.

  • Reproduce mural-scale pieces as precise vinyl wall decals
  • Print full-color designs on apparel and skate decks
  • Scale bold tag-style lettering down for brand logo use

Can I convert and sell a photo of graffiti I didn't create?

Be cautious — graffiti art is subject to the same copyright protections as any artwork, and using someone else's piece commercially without permission carries real legal risk. Create original graffiti-style art instead, or get explicit permission from the artist.

How do I capture drip effects accurately?

Drips have soft, gradient-like edges — use the Photo preset with a moderate-to-high color count rather than the flat Icon preset, which would harden the naturally soft drip edges into blocky shapes.
